About the Role
The Senior Wayside & On‑Board Service Engineer will support CBTC subsystems on metro projects, performing maintenance under an annual contract to ensure system availability. The role is based in Noida with the expectation to relocate between sites as business needs dictate. • Execute on‑site maintenance per contractual KPIs and system checklists. • Provide expert‑level support to NMRC staff for routine maintenance and basic troubleshooting. • Supervise maintenance activities and troubleshoot failures. • Coordinate with CBTC design team and overseas product experts for critical issue resolution and root‑cause analysis. • Analyze failures, generate reports, and communicate business updates. • Download and analyze ZC, front‑am, and CC logs to resolve errors and warnings. • Verify system configuration, upload software updates, and maintain CBTC wayside and onboard systems. • Reboot servers/machines according to schedule and ensure proper documentation of work. • Follow Metro rail safety permits and conduct safety checks after maintenance. • Perform shift and emergency duties, providing 24×7 telephonic support as required. • Monitor daily maintenance performance and produce technical reports for the client. • Manage stock availability and activate repair processes.

What You Bring
• Minimum 5 years (degree) or 7 years (diploma) experience in CBTC systems for metro/rail signalling. • In‑depth knowledge of wayside and onboard CBTC equipment such as CC, BTM modules, front‑am, ZC, and balises. • Familiarity with power‑supply equipment and connectors used in automatic train control (ATC) systems. • Basic understanding of switches and communication networks. • Strong client‑facing and internal communication skills, both written and verbal. • Ability to work under pressure with efficient troubleshooting. • Degree or Diploma in Electrical, Electronics, Computer Science, or Instrumentation Engineering from a recognized university.
